In Spain, they have El Cid. In England, it's Robin Hood. France has Roland, but in Switzerland, it's William Tell! The Apple and the Arrow is an epic tale of the legendary Swiss marksman who was famously forced to shoot an apple off his own son's head because he refused to pay homage to a Hapsburg tyrant in the early 14th century.
